Report on first FDA staff forum to be held in Ireland


On 15 October 2003 100 staff of FDA member companies in Ireland turned out to listen to none other than their home-grown hero - Jack Charlton OBE - at the first ever FDA Staff Forum to be held in Ireland. The evening was a huge success, with double the projected numbers expected, and an evening that all who attended will remember for a long time.

The evening, generously sponsored by Matheson Ormsby Prentice (still celebrating winning 'European Law Firm of the Year 2002'), began with our chairman and the MD of Bank of Ireland Finance, Ann Horan, outlining the evening's programme. She then introduced the first speaker - Jeff Grout from JG Consulting.
